• Turn the saw to the side
• Apply a generous amount of SAE 20 oil to the shaft end
and bronze bearings.
• Let the lubricant oil work in overnight.
• Repeat the procedure the next day on the other side of
the saw.
Warning: In the interests of operational safety, always switch off the saw and remove the mains plug before carrying out maintenance
work.
